28173 sujets

CSS et mise en forme, CSS3

RE-Bonjour,

Je rencontre un problème de positionnement sous ie d'un formulaire de recherche mais sous firefox

Je vous envoie le lien pour que vous puissiez voir le soucis rencontré !

http://lmdi.be/index.php

Merci d'avance !
Modifié par cyberchrix (25 May 2006 - 16:30)
Salut,

Tu es sûrement victime du IE Doubled Float-Margin. Comme son nom l'indique, ce bug entraîne un doublement des marges d'un éléments positionner en flottant. Ainsi, dans ton cas, ton élément div#recherche h2possède une marge gauche de 400px au lieu des 200px indiqués.

Pour résoudre ce problème, il suffit d'ajouter la propriété display: inline; à ton élément flottant.

Voici un lien (en) qui présente plus en détail ce petit bug.

Juste une petite question pour finir. Pourquoi utilises-tu la balise <h2> pour créer le nom du champ de ton formulaire alors que la balise <label> est spécialement faite pour cela Smiley hum ?

Bonne continuation Smiley cligne .
Modifié par ymhotepa (25 May 2006 - 17:26)
Merci ymhotepa , ça fonctionne !!! et pour l'histoire du <h2> , il est vrai que j'aurais pu utiliser le <label> ... j'en prend note !!!